Integration of Solar Panels into EV Charging Stations


Energy Efficiency and Sustainability

One of the primary benefits of integrating solar panels into EV charging stations is the potential for increased energy efficiency and sustainability. Solar panels harness energy from the sun, a renewable resource, reducing the reliance on fossil fuels and decreasing greenhouse gas emissions. This aligns with the broader goal of promoting clean energy and reducing the carbon footprint of transportation.


Cost Considerations

While the initial investment in OEM solar panels and the installation of solar-powered EV charging stations can be significant, the long-term savings are substantial. Solar energy is free once the panels are installed, leading to lower operational costs for charging stations. Additionally, government incentives and subsidies for renewable energy projects can offset some of the initial expenses, making solar-powered EV charging stations a financially viable option.


Challenges and Solutions


Weather Dependence

One of the challenges of using solar panels for EV charging stations is their dependence on weather conditions. Solar panels require sunlight to generate electricity, which can be a limitation in regions with frequent cloud cover or limited sunlight. However, advancements in solar technology, such as the development of more efficient panels and energy storage solutions, can mitigate this issue. Energy storage systems, such as batteries, can store excess energy generated during sunny periods for use during cloudy days or nighttime.


Space Requirements

Another challenge is the space required for installing solar panels. EV charging stations need to accommodate both the charging infrastructure and the solar panels, which can be a constraint in urban areas with limited space. Innovative solutions, such as integrating solar panels into the design of parking structures or using solar canopies, can help overcome this challenge by maximizing the use of available space.
